Python編程之求數字平方的實例
求輸入數字的平方,如果平方運算后小于 100 則退出。
源代碼:#!/usr/bin/python# -*- coding: UTF-8 -*- TRUE = 1FALSE = 0def SQ(x): return x * xprint ’如果輸入的數字小于 100,程序將停止運行。’again = 1while again: num = int(raw_input(’請輸入一個數字:’)) print ’運算結果為: %d’ % (SQ(num)) if SQ(num) >= 100: again = TRUE else: again = FALSE輸出結果如下:
如果輸入的數字小于 100,程序將停止運行。請輸入一個數字:12運算結果為: 144請輸入一個數字:14運算結果為: 196請輸入一個數字:20運算結果為: 400請輸入一個數字:30運算結果為: 900請輸入一個數字:11運算結果為: 121請輸入一個數字:100運算結果為: 10000請輸入一個數字:21運算結果為: 441請輸入一個數字:8運算結果為: 64
補充:求輸入數字的平方,如果平方運算后小于 50 則退出
while True:num=int(input(’請輸入數字’))s=num*numif s<50:break
以上為個人經驗,希望能給大家一個參考,也希望大家多多支持好吧啦網。如有錯誤或未考慮完全的地方,望不吝賜教。
相關文章:
1. 編程語言PHP在Web開發領域的優勢在哪?2. 詳解Android studio 動態fragment的用法3. 圖文詳解vue中proto文件的函數調用4. 什么是python的自省5. 基于android studio的layout的xml文件的創建方式6. Spring Boot和Thymeleaf整合結合JPA實現分頁效果(實例代碼)7. 解決Android studio xml界面無法預覽問題8. Android如何加載Base64編碼格式圖片9. Vue封裝一個TodoList的案例與瀏覽器本地緩存的應用實現10. Springboot Druid 自定義加密數據庫密碼的幾種方案

網公網安備